Envista Holdings shares have surged 37.1% over the past 12 months, far outpacing the dental products industry's 30.3% decline and the S&P 500's 28.2% gain. The company's first-quarter 2026 results showed 8.4% core growth in Specialty Products & Technologies and 11.5% in Equipment and Consumables, driven by new product launches including the Nobel S Series implants, Spark clear aligners in Japan, and AI-enhanced DEXIS software. Gross margin expanded 100 basis points and adjusted EBITDA margin rose 120 basis points, even as the company offset an $11 million increase in tariff costs. Envista also acquired Versah for about $54.7 million, adding the Densah Burs osseodensification system to its implant portfolio. The Zacks Consensus Estimate projects 2026 earnings per share of $1.42, up 19.3% year over year, on revenue of $2.86 billion.
